Scope and Content

To Mr Bingham of Uxbridge, Middlesex, re her concern over the future prospects of her twelve year old nephew [John William], whose father is about to take him away from school. The boy has sense and the capacity to learn under supervision.

She refers to another nephew [Charles Wesley), who Sally had placed at St Paul's School, and who had showed great talent, and the certainty of winning a place at Oxford. He is now apprenticed to Mr Rivers, the apothecary.
